For example, a 1 micromolar (1 µM) solution contains 1 micromole of solute in every liter of solution. How to calculate the number of moles? The number of moles represents the fraction: mass of the compound / molecular weight of the compound. Nov 10, 2014 · PAR is defined in terms of photon (quantum) flux, specifically, the number of moles of photons in the radiant energy between 400 nm and 700 nm.
